Notes: Injected fuel. Ran this car after the first one was crashed earlier in the year. Became Leroy Dugan's "Bushwhacker" in 1968. | Roger Caster had been associated with Hayden Proffitt and Grady Bryant and had formerly worked for Dick Harrell before he and Grady teamed up on a match race stocker. The first car they built was totaled in Tulsa, so this car was its replacement. The new Nova used a T-Bar chassis with a Mopar rear carrying 4.30 gears. Henry Schroeder of T-Bar also did the aluminum floor. The engine was a .060 overbored "Rat" that used a Crankshaft Company crank. Stock rods held 12.5:1 Forgedtrue pistons. The heads were stock, including the valves. The cam came from Erson. The team ran 48% nitro for fuel, and it was fed to the motor by Hilborn injectors. The transmission was a TorqueFlite, and the rear end was also a Mopar unit that used 4.30 gears. The first time out, the car ran 9.30s and 9.40s. This was one of the few Chevys that was able to beat Gene Snow at the time. ET 1966 (1/67 Drag Strip) mph Green Valley 1966 (6/3/66 Drag World)

Notes: Both Buckel and Jim Thornton drove this car as members of the Ramchargers team. Acid-dipped at AeroChem, it was raced in 2% A/FX form at the 1965 Winternationals, then converted to full AWB status. Ran gas, later fuel, and was the factory test bed for some of the Hilborn injector development. Car is noted for clocking the first 8-second doorslammer time slip at 8.910/148.66 at Cecil County on August 7/1965 (Thornton driving - 50% fuel, 472" stroker). This was after an accident Buckel had at Detroit Dragway during the team's first attempt at running nitro a weekend prior. That flip crushed the acid-dipped roof and rear quarters. Alexander Brothers rebuilt it quickly, so the car was still in primer during the record-setting run. Buckel could have run better numbers than this, as 150.50 mph in a for sale ad, a 9.83 at 140+ mph at Milan, a 9.36/146.00 at Ubly and a 157.00 at Detroit are all attributed to the car, but driver is not listed. Those were run either by Buckel or Jim Thornton. (6/12/65 Drag News)

Notes: The "Ramcharger" Dart was not a flip-top FC. The roof lifted off for access to the cockpit. The Dart body appeared stock but was actually narrowed six inches. Mike was at Cecil County on April 16 for a best-of-three-match race against Don Gay and his "Infinity" GTO. The first race was a classic, as Buckel's 8.37/168.85 narrowly beat Gay's 8.45/163. Unfortunately, the Pontiac blew its transmission, so it was out of competition. Jim Liberman was there as a backup car in his new Nova, so he filled in. In the next race, Mike's 8.63/168.85 easily beat the Nova's ailing 9.53/145. The third race saw Jim pick up half a second to 9.03/159, but it still wasn't enough to win against Mike's 8.53/168.53. | One of their injected Darts (I believe this one) had a removable roof. They ran both with and without it. It was also a subframe car. Built by Woody Gilmore, as I remember. - NH

Notes: Chuck Finders-built chassis, one-piece fiberglass shell from Fiberglass Trends. 396 semi-hemi with a Crankshaft Company stroker bringing it to 454 cubes, set back behind cowl. Goosed through a C&O Torqueflite trans. Initially injected. went to blower in 1968. Car featured in 5/67 Popular Hot Rodding. Car was reportedly sold to Gene Conway in '68, who replaced the front clip with a Firebird piece and swapped the Chev mill for an early hemi. Car was run under the C&O Automotive banner until Conway moved to a series of Corvette floppers. Notes: Mike Burkhart's first funny car was this steel Chevy II match basher. Burkhart was a terror with his Super Stock '57 Chevrolet Bel Air in the Dallas area. In 1965, Mike built the steel Chevrolet with big block injected Chevy power. Friendly Chevrolet sponsored the stretched wheelbased car. Burkhart won many match races with the strangely painted Chevy II (it was red on one side and blue on the other). Mike was a regular in Texas match races with the Chevy II in 1966, but retired the car at the end of the season to build a Camaro for 1967.
